Texas's own H-E-B has clinched the title of America's favorite grocery chain, according to the latest Dunhumby Retailer Preference Index. The store, which is a staple in its home state and only has presence in Mexico outside of it, tops the list for the third time, leaving e-commerce giant Amazon and popular chain Trader Joe's trailing behind, as reported by Chron.

With a history stretching back to 1905, H-E-B has become not just a business but a part of the Texan identity for many. Despite only recently expanding to north Texas, with its first stores in Frisco and Plano in 2022 and a Fort Worth opening just last month, the grocer has fostered an intense loyalty among Texans. For instance, none store has yet made its way within the Dallas city limits, yet it's the preferred grocer in countless other communities, the Houston Chronicle details.

H-E-B's success has been attributed to its response to customer needs and its willingness to support local events and causes, building a strong community bond. The company's dedication was further put on display during crises such as Winter Storm Uri in 2021, where H-E-B acted swiftly to provide for the community. Such actions have only solidified the grocer’s position as not just a store but a trusted ally in the public eye.

According to Chron, Dunhumby’s analysis combined financial performance with customer perception, two aspects where H-E-B excelled, particularly in the areas of savings and product assortment. While Amazon may have a lead in digital capabilities, H-E-B earned recognition as one of the regional grocery stores most equipped to stand toe-to-toe with 'digital goliaths' like Amazon, Target, and Walmart.

It's not just competitive pricing or product quality that has propelled H-E-B to the forefront—it's also their commitment to diverse consumer needs. They've managed to win over customers looking for savings, quality, and personalized service. As the Dunhumby report states, these retailers "have customer bases with distinct needs and a critical competitive advantage that aligns perfectly with those needs," as per Chron.
